Pg. Vissio et al., STRUCTURE AND CELL-TYPE DISTRIBUTION IN THE PITUITARY-GLAND OF PEJERREY ODONTESTHES BONARIENSIS, Fisheries science, 63(1), 1997, pp. 64-68
Antisera raised against piscine pituitary hormones and heterologous an
tisera against mammalian pituitary hormones were used to analyze the t
ypes and distribution patterns of cells in the adenohypophysis of peje
rrey Odontesthes bonariensis. Prolactin (PRL) cells were immunostained
in the external border of the rostral pars distalis using anti-chum s
almon PRL and anti-carp PRL. Immunoreactive (ir-)corticotrophic (ACTH)
cells were identified in the same area using anti-human ACTH and cros
s-reactivity was observed in the pars intermedia (PI), corresponding t
o the presumptive melanocyte-stimulating hormone cells. Ir-growth horm
one (GH) cells were identified in close contact with the neuro-hypophy
sis in the proximal pars distalis (PPD) using anti-chum salmon GH and
anti-carp GH antisera. Ir-gonadotrophic (GtH) cells were distributed i
n the PPD and in the external area of the PI. Two forms of GtH were id
entified using antisera raised against chum salmon GtH I beta and GtH
II beta and anti-croaker maturational GtH. Ir-thyroid-stimulating horm
one (TSH) cells were revealed with an anti-human TSH beta antiserum in
the PPD. Ir-somatolactin (SL) cells were detected in the PI using two
antisera raised against chum salmon and red drum SL.
